Fully inclusive service
Our fees include all activities, formula milk, nappies, nappy cream, baby wipes, sun cream, freshly prepared, and award-winning well-balanced meals and snacks throughout the day.

What happens next?
Once you have completed and submitted your registration form we will keep in touch with you regularly. If the space you require is available we will confirm this in writing and ask for the first month’s fees to be paid in advance – we do offer payment options which we will be happy to discuss with you. If the space is not currently available we will add you to our waiting list.
As we get closer to your start date we will organise some settling in sessions for you to meet your Key Person and share some time with your child in their room. This is a great way for us to get to know you and your child, and you to know us.
